Orange County Mayor Jerry Demings has opened a campaign account to run for governor in 2026, according to the state Division of Elections website. Demings is the second prominent Democrat to file paperwork for the race, joining former Congressman David Jolly.
The account, opened Friday, allows Demings to raise money for the campaign. Demings is expected to make an announcement about his plans Thursday at the Rosen Centre in Orlando, according to various media outlets. Demings, a former Orlando police chief and former Orange County sheriff, has been mayor since 2018. He is married to Val Demings, who served in the U.S. House from 2017 to 2023. She lost a bid for the U.S. Senate in 2022 to then-Sen. Marco Rubio, who is now U.S. Secretary of State.
U.S. Rep. Byron Donalds and former state House Speaker Paul Renner are seeking the Republican nomination for governor.
